ENGINE:
*Well maintained JDM F22B swap with automatic transmission. (DD'd) Would go for JDM F20B swap one day.
*JDM type S Intake (Thanks old prelude enthusiast Craig! :bigok
*FULL aluminum radiator
*Rear battery relocation
Thats all on my mind, but I will add if I forgot something

Just use the dizzy of the engine that is in your car now, the reason they say to change is because JDM engines always come with internal coil dizzys so it's just easier to use one off the H23a1 or H22a1/4 since the harness is wired for it. If you have an H22 in your car now you can use the IM from that, if not it would be a good time to look for a nice IM, the Rosko Euro R is a great choice for a street car.
